Breakfast Burrito Bowl (Print Version)

# Ingredients:

→ Main Components

01 - Salt and pepper, as much as you'd like
02 - 1 tablespoon of butter
03 - 2 or 3 big eggs

→ Extras for the Top

04 - ½ avocado sliced into small pieces (optional)
05 - A quarter cup of cheddar cheese, grated
06 - 3 tablespoons of fresh salsa

→ Optional Add-Ons

07 - Hot sauce of your liking
08 - Crispy tortilla chips or strips
09 - Chopped cilantro leaves
10 - Crumbly cheese like Cotija or queso fresco
11 - A dollop of sour cream

# Instructions:

01 - On low-medium heat, warm up a cast iron or heavy pan until it's hot.
02 - Crack the eggs into a medium bowl and whisk until smooth and airy. Stir in a pinch of salt and pepper to taste while mixing.
03 - Drop the butter in and swirl it around so it melts and coats the skillet evenly.
04 - Pour the beaten eggs into your pan, letting them spread out evenly. After 20-30 seconds, use a silicone spatula to gently scrape around the edges.
05 - Run your spatula gently through the eggs to form soft, fluffy chunks. Keep stirring and cooking for 1-2 minutes until they're moist but fully set.
06 - Move your eggs to a serving bowl. Scatter cheddar cheese, salsa, and avocado chunks on top. Add whatever extra toppings you'd like as well.
07 - Eat immediately so the eggs stay warm and your cheese begins to melt.

# Notes:

01 - To keep it dairy-free, swap the butter for avocado or coconut oil, and use cheese alternatives or skip it.
02 - Throw in chopped-up cooked meat like sausage, bacon, or ham for a heartier meal.
03 - Saute diced onions and peppers beforehand for extra flavor and veggies.
